How much does it cost to rent an apartment in La Conchita?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
La Conchita Studio Apartments | $2,730 | $1,650 | $3,159 |
La Conchita 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,026 | $1,250 | $3,767 |
La Conchita 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,575 | $2,190 | $5,064 |
La Conchita 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,837 | $2,805 | $6,539 |
